Nik Shamov, CEO and founder of Neon, discusses how the company aims to become the default Postgres offering in the cloud by providing a serverless Postgres offering. Neon has experienced significant growth and differentiates itself from other cloud offerings by focusing on developer productivity.
Neon’s Mission and Success
Neon’s mission is to empower the application development lifecycle by providing a serverless Postgres offering. They have onboarded 400,000 databases on the platform within a year since their launch, showcasing significant growth.

Investments and Growth
Neon is making significant investments into improving the overall quality of the service, particularly uptime, security, availability, and robustness. They are also focused on enhancing the developer experience and plan to roll out new features, including AI-powered functionalities.
